Why Supporting Local Businesses Matters in Hamilton

Hamilton town centre is home to a fantastic mix of shops, cafés, services, and organisations – each playing a vital role in keeping our community thriving. Choosing to support local isn’t just about convenience; it’s about investing in the future of our town.

1. Keeping Money in Hamilton

When you spend with local businesses, more of that money stays right here in Hamilton. It helps pay local wages, supports other nearby suppliers, and circulates within our economy – creating a stronger, more resilient town centre.

2. Supporting Jobs & Opportunities

Local businesses are often run by families, friends, and neighbours. Every purchase you make helps sustain jobs and create new opportunities for people in our community.

3. Creating a Vibrant Town Centre

Independent businesses bring character and variety. They make Hamilton a more attractive place to shop, visit, and spend time – which in turn draws in more people and investment.

4. Building a Stronger Community

Many local businesses give back by sponsoring community events, supporting charities, or helping out with local initiatives. By supporting them, you’re also helping strengthen the wider community.

5. Reducing Environmental Impact

Shopping closer to home means fewer car journeys and reduced carbon emissions. Supporting Hamilton’s businesses is a greener choice.

6. Securing Our Future

Like many towns, Hamilton faces challenges from changing shopping habits and the rise of online retail. By choosing local first, you’re helping to safeguard our town centre for the future.


Together, We Keep Hamilton Thriving

Every time you buy a coffee, pick up a gift, get your hair cut, or choose to eat out in Hamilton, you’re making a positive difference. Supporting local is about more than shopping – it’s about celebrating and sustaining the place we call home.
